B - RYA YA Competent Crew Course

Book Online

 Duration /Options: 

  • 5 days or            
  • 3 x 2 day weekends or
  • A 2 day and a 3 day weekend                     

Recommended Previous Experience: 

  • None required but
  • Strongly suggest YA Keelboat Set Sail and YA Keelboat Skipper
  • Completed our Start Yachting course or
  • 12 months dinghy sailing as skipper                                         

Course Overview: Basic seamanship and helmsmanship                                                                                                           

Ability after course: Basic Knowledge of yachting . By the end of the course  you should be able to steer , handle sails, keep a lookout, row a dinghy and assist in all the day to day routines.

This course is for beginners and those who would like to become active crew members rather than just passengers. By the end of the course you should be able to steer, handle sails, keep a lookout, and assist in all the day to day routines.

It is also an ideal stepping stone for dinghy sailors to try yachting and for those who have already done some crewing but wish to learn the right way.

At the end of the 5 days you will have become a competent crew. With your new confidence you will find the course very enjoyable. 

During your 5 days aboard you will visit anchorages off the beaten track and if the weather allows, complete a longer coastal passage.

With a maximum of 5 students per course, your fully qualified instructors devote plenty of time to your individual needs. Safety is paramount, you will learn how to operate all safty equipment including flares, lifejackets, safety harnesses, liferafts, how to assist the recovery of a man overboard and participate in at least four hours of night time sailing during the course.

You will be awarded the RYA YA Competent Crew Certificate and be an asset to any crew you join.

Next StepRYA YA Basic Navigation and Safety Course for small craft users such as RIB's and day boats or RYA YA Day Skipper Shorebased Theory for cruising yachts.
